Beispiel #1
0
 public CartController(CartViewModelBuilder miniCartViewModelBuilder, RequestModelAccessor requestModelAccessor, RouteRequestLookupInfoAccessor routeRequestLookupInfoAccessor, ModuleECommerce moduleECommerce)
 {
     _cartViewModelBuilder           = miniCartViewModelBuilder;
     _requestModelAccessor           = requestModelAccessor;
     _routeRequestLookupInfoAccessor = routeRequestLookupInfoAccessor;
     _moduleECommerce = moduleECommerce;
 }
 public DeliveryMethodService(
     ChannelService channelService,
     ModuleECommerce moduleECommerce)
 {
     this.channelService  = channelService;
     this.moduleECommerce = moduleECommerce;
 }
Beispiel #3
0
        public OrderViewModelBuilder(
            RequestModelAccessor requestModelAccessor,
            FieldDefinitionService fieldDefinitionService,
            LanguageService languageService,
            PaymentService paymentService,
            PageService pageServcie,
            UrlService urlService,
            ModuleECommerce moduleECommerce,
            SecurityToken securityToken,
            ProductModelBuilder productModelBuilder,
            VariantService variantService,
            UnitOfMeasurementService unitOfMeasurementService,
            OrganizationService organizationService,
            PersonStorage personStorage)
        {
            _requestModelAccessor   = requestModelAccessor;
            _fieldDefinitionService = fieldDefinitionService;
            _languageService        = languageService;
            _paymentService         = paymentService;
            _pageServcie            = pageServcie;
            _urlService             = urlService;

            _moduleECommerce          = moduleECommerce;
            _securityToken            = securityToken;
            _productModelBuilder      = productModelBuilder;
            _variantService           = variantService;
            _unitOfMeasurementService = unitOfMeasurementService;
            _organizationService      = organizationService;
            _personStorage            = personStorage;
        }
Beispiel #4
0
 public OrderConfirmationViewModelBuilder(RequestModelAccessor requestModelAccessor,
                                          ModuleECommerce moduleECommerce,
                                          OrderViewModelBuilder orderViewModelBuilder)
 {
     _requestModelAccessor  = requestModelAccessor;
     _moduleECommerce       = moduleECommerce;
     _orderViewModelBuilder = orderViewModelBuilder;
 }
Beispiel #5
0
 public ProductsAreInStock(ModuleECommerce moduleECommerce, SecurityToken securityToken, IStockStatusCalculator stockStatusCalculator, VariantService variantService, RequestModelAccessor requestModelAccessor)
 {
     _moduleECommerce       = moduleECommerce;
     _securityToken         = securityToken;
     _stockStatusCalculator = stockStatusCalculator;
     _variantService        = variantService;
     _requestModelAccessor  = requestModelAccessor;
 }
Beispiel #6
0
 public DeliveryMethodViewModelBuilder(
     RequestModelAccessor requestModelAccessor,
     CartService cartService,
     ModuleECommerce moduleECommerce,
     CartAccessor cartAccessor)
 {
     _moduleECommerce      = moduleECommerce;
     _requestModelAccessor = requestModelAccessor;
     _cartService          = cartService;
     _cartAccessor         = cartAccessor;
 }
Beispiel #7
0
 public CartViewModelBuilder(CartService cartService, RequestModelAccessor requestModelAccessor, UrlService urlService,
                             VariantService variantService, BaseProductService baseProductService, ModuleECommerce moduleECommerce,
                             UnitOfMeasurementService unitOfMeasurementService)
 {
     _cartService              = cartService;
     _requestModelAccessor     = requestModelAccessor;
     _urlService               = urlService;
     _variantService           = variantService;
     _baseProductService       = baseProductService;
     _moduleECommerce          = moduleECommerce;
     _unitOfMeasurementService = unitOfMeasurementService;
 }
Beispiel #8
0
 public PaymentMethodViewModelBuilder(
     ModuleECommerce moduleECommerce,
     PaymentService paymentService,
     SecurityToken securityToken,
     CartService cartService,
     RequestModelAccessor requestModelAccessor,
     CartAccessor cartAccessor
     )
 {
     _moduleECommerce      = moduleECommerce;
     _paymentService       = paymentService;
     _requestModelAccessor = requestModelAccessor;
     _securityToken        = securityToken;
     _cartService          = cartService;
     _cartAccessor         = cartAccessor;
 }
 public OrderHistoryViewModelBuilder(
     RequestModelAccessor requestModelAccessor,
     SecurityContextService securityContextService,
     UrlService urlService,
     LanguageService languageService,
     ModuleECommerce moduleECommerce,
     OrderViewModelBuilder orderViewModelBuilder,
     PersonStorage personStorage)
 {
     _requestModelAccessor   = requestModelAccessor;
     _securityContextService = securityContextService;
     _urlService             = urlService;
     _languageService        = languageService;
     _moduleECommerce        = moduleECommerce;
     _orderViewModelBuilder  = orderViewModelBuilder;
     _personStorage          = personStorage;
 }
 public CheckoutController(
     CheckoutViewModelBuilder checkoutViewModelBuilder,
     RequestModelAccessor requestModelAccessor,
     CheckoutService checkoutService,
     UrlService urlService,
     PageService pageService,
     ModuleECommerce moduleECommerce,
     CartAccessor cartAccessor)
 {
     _checkoutViewModelBuilder = checkoutViewModelBuilder;
     _checkoutService          = checkoutService;
     _requestModelAccessor     = requestModelAccessor;
     _urlService      = urlService;
     _pageService     = pageService;
     _moduleECommerce = moduleECommerce;
     _cartAccessor    = cartAccessor;
 }
 public PaymentWidgetService(
     SecurityToken securityToken,
     ModuleECommerce moduleECommerce,
     TargetGroupEngine targetGroupEngine,
     CartAccessor cartAccessor,
     ChannelService channelService,
     LanguageService languageService,
     DistributedLockService distributedLockService)
 {
     _cartAccessor           = cartAccessor;
     _channelService         = channelService;
     _languageService        = languageService;
     _distributedLockService = distributedLockService;
     _securityToken          = securityToken;
     _targetGroupEngine      = targetGroupEngine;
     _moduleECommerce        = moduleECommerce;
 }
 public CheckoutServiceImpl(
     ModuleECommerce moduleECommerce,
     RequestModelAccessor requestModelAccessor,
     CartService cartService,
     IPaymentInfoFactory paymentInfoFactory,
     LanguageService languageService,
     UserValidationService userValidationService,
     SecurityContextService securityContextService,
     PersonService personService,
     LoginService loginService,
     MailService mailService,
     WelcomeEmailDefinitionResolver welcomeEmailDefinitionResolver,
     FieldTemplateService templateService,
     WebsiteService websiteService,
     AddressTypeService addressTypeService,
     UrlService urlService,
     PageService pageService,
     PersonStorage personStorage,
     CheckoutState checkoutState)
 {
     _moduleECommerce                = moduleECommerce;
     _requestModelAccessor           = requestModelAccessor;
     _cartService                    = cartService;
     _paymentInfoFactory             = paymentInfoFactory;
     _languageService                = languageService;
     _userValidationService          = userValidationService;
     _securityContextService         = securityContextService;
     _personService                  = personService;
     _loginService                   = loginService;
     _mailService                    = mailService;
     _welcomeEmailDefinitionResolver = welcomeEmailDefinitionResolver;
     _templateService                = templateService;
     _addressTypeService             = addressTypeService;
     _websiteService                 = websiteService;
     _pageService                    = pageService;
     _personStorage                  = personStorage;
     _checkoutState                  = checkoutState;
     _urlService = urlService;
 }
Beispiel #13
0
 public ProductServiceImpl(RelationshipTypeService relationshipTypeService, RelatedModelBuilder relatedModelBuilder, ModuleECommerce moduleECommerce, VariantService variantService)
 {
     _relationshipTypeService = relationshipTypeService;
     _relatedModelBuilder     = relatedModelBuilder;
     _moduleECommerce         = moduleECommerce;
 }
 public DeliveryMethodValidator(ModuleECommerce moduleECommerce, ChannelService channelService)
 {
     _moduleECommerce = moduleECommerce;
     _channelService  = channelService;
 }
Beispiel #15
0
 public OrderGrandTotalHasNotChanged(ModuleECommerce moduleECommerce, SecurityToken securityToken)
 {
     _moduleECommerce = moduleECommerce;
     _securityToken   = securityToken;
 }
 public CampaignCodeValidator(ModuleECommerce moduleECommerce, SecurityToken securityToken)
 {
     _moduleECommerce = moduleECommerce;
     _securityToken   = securityToken;
 }
Beispiel #17
0
 public PaymentMethodValidator(ModuleECommerce moduleECommerce, ChannelService channelService)
 {
     _moduleECommerce = moduleECommerce;
     _channelService  = channelService;
 }
Beispiel #18
0
 public OrderHistoryViewModelService(ModuleECommerce moduleECommerce, SecurityToken securityToken)
 {
     _moduleECommerce = moduleECommerce;
     _securityToken   = securityToken;
 }
Beispiel #19
0
 public PaymentServiceImpl(ModuleECommerce moduleECommerce)
 {
     _moduleECommerce = moduleECommerce;
 }